What is the Fence Permit Application?
The Fence Permit Application is a crucial document that allows property owners to secure permission for constructing or modifying fences. It plays a significant role in ensuring compliance with local regulations and maintaining safety standards. Obtaining a fence permit is not just a formality; it is essential for legal reasons and protecting property values.
This application covers various types of fences, including pool barriers and commercial privacy fences, each serving unique purposes within residential and commercial settings.

Who Needs the Fence Permit Application?
The Fence Permit Application is necessary for a diverse range of individuals and scenarios. Homeowners and renters contemplating any fence construction or alterations must file this application. Additionally, commercial property owners intending to install security or privacy fences are required to obtain one.
Certain geographic areas, especially those with pools or other regulated structures, may have specific requirements for barriers necessitating a permit.

Who is eligible to submit a Fence Permit Application?
Any property owner or authorized contractor can submit a Fence Permit Application. It’s vital to ensure you have the landowner's consent if you are a contractor.
What details are required on the Fence Permit Application?
Applicants must provide their information, project address, type of fence, construction valuation, linear footage, fence height, and type of posts to complete the application.
How do I submit the Fence Permit Application once completed?
You can submit your completed Fence Permit Application either directly through the pdfFiller platform or by downloading and mailing it to your local government office.
Are there deadlines for submitting the Fence Permit Application?
While specific deadlines may vary by municipality, it’s best to submit your application well in advance of your intended construction date to account for processing times.
What common mistakes should I avoid while filling out the application?
Ensure all fields are completely filled out and double-check spelling and numerical entries. One common mistake is neglecting to provide accurate measurements.
How long does it take to process the Fence Permit Application?
Processing times vary depending on local authorities but typically range from a few days to a few weeks. It’s advisable to check with your local office for precise timelines.
Will I need any supporting documents with my application?
Yes, you may need to provide a site plan or property survey along with your application to illustrate where the fence will be located on the property.
